Slow-Cooker Pork Ribs


I found this recipe in an album on Chicago Foodie Sisters Facebook page and decided to start it before work today.  I made some changes to the seasonings from what they used but pretty much stayed with their recipe.  








Like they said in the recipe, it isn't pretty, but it is very tender and delicious!!












I started with a 4 pound slab of pork ribs.  I rubbed in Garlic Salt, Montreal Steak Seasoning, Pepper, Celery Salt, Chili Powder and Brown Sugar. 







Next I put about an inch of water in the slow-cooker, added the ribs and covered them with Worchestershire Sauce, A-1 Sauce and Barb-Be-Que Sauce.





My Crock-Pot has settings for every two hours so I set it in Low for 8 hours for it would be ready when I got home.


Almost perfect.  


The only thing I would change would be to use more meat.
